My family stayed for a week and had an enjoyable experience. We had a suite on the 3rd floor, with a king size bed in the main bedroom room and two doubles in the room closest to the hall. Our room had a terrific view of Lake Superior with a nice little balcony. It's an older property and could use some updating. You can really see the age in the bathroom and furnishings in the room, but was clean and comfortable. They offer a hot breakfast with a standard offering of scrambled eggs, rotation of potatoes and/or sausage, and waffles. The also have an attached conference center, which could be very useful for business travelers. The staff was pleasant, but shied away from engaging with us unless asked a direct question. Could be that they see so many tourists that they may be experiencing a little burn out. Grandma's Marathon was the week following our visit, so they could be focused on that as well. Either way, they were professional. The real selling point is its location. You're right in the middle of everything with most of the shops and restaurants being within walking distance. You also have access to the excellent walking path that runs along the lake. If you're staying in Duluth, they are definitely worth a look.
